All local fly shops have experts to help you as well, especially picking out fly rods. But you can always get started with the lightest fly rod combo kit from sporting good store for under $50. We recommend 4 and 5 weight rods from these stores.

FYI, things you must bring for the guide fishing
- Fishing License and Discover Pass
- Lightest fly rod
- Waders with Felt Boots Recommended
- Water and snacks
- Eye protection like sunglasses.
- Size 16 to 20 Barbless Nymphs are recommended (see photo).
